Navi Mumbai Earns Top Honour In Swachh Survekshan Citizen Feedback Category
Navi Mumbai has achieved significant recognition in the Swachh Survekshan 2024, securing the prestigious title of Best City in the Citizen Feedback category. This distinction, alongside its inclusion in the newly introduced ‘Super Swachh League’, underscores the exceptional public support and satisfaction regarding the city’s cleanliness, sanitation services, and civic engagement initiatives. The achievement highlights strong community involvement and trust in the Navi Mumbai Municipal Corporation’s NMMC efforts.
Citizen feedback forms a crucial component of the national cleanliness ranking, evaluating cities based on public perception, awareness of sanitation initiatives, and residents’ direct experiences with municipal services. Navi Mumbai secured the highest score in this critical category, reflecting a remarkable level of community participation and confidence in the local administration. Over the past year, NMMC intensified its focus on public outreach through extensive awareness drives, leveraging digital platforms, fostering local partnerships, and launching community initiatives.
A notable program, ‘Parisar Sakhi,’ actively engaged women waste pickers in door to door collection efforts. Furthermore, the civic body actively encouraged on site composting and promoted zero waste models within residential societies, thereby deepening resident involvement in sustainable waste management practices. This comprehensive approach, rooted in citizen collaboration, has evidently propelled Navi Mumbai to the forefront of urban cleanliness.
